The Giant Buddhas, Silver Dove at Leipzig
The jury for the 48th Leipzig international film Festival of documentary and animation (Germany) unanimously awarded the Silver Dove toThe Giant Buddhas by Christian Frei, experimental film about terror and tolerance surrounding the destruction of the Bamiyan statues of Boudha, in Afghanistan. The director, maker of War Photographer and who has won several awards and was nominated for an Oscar for Best Foreign Film in 2002, was hailed by the jury: "The filmmaker treated a political event with sensibility and brought powerful symbolism to an event that has recently been in the news. He understood the complexity of the problem, using considered reflection and bringing a cultural perspective to television news". Screened in world premiere at the recent Locarno Festival and acclaimed at the Toronto International Festival, The Giant Buddhas now receives an important prize. The film will be shown in October at international festivals such as Vancouver, Vienna and Valladolid, and in Copenhagen in November.
